Story Summary: Title: "Alice's Tales in Wonderland" Author: Lewis Carroll

"The Adventures of Alice in Wonderland" follows the journey of a young woman named
Alice who falls down the rabbit hole and finds herself in a fantasy world full of strange
creatures and nothing important circumstances. Throughout her adventure, Alice meets
talking animals, plays croquet with the Queen of Hearts, attends a tea party with the
Mad Hatter and the March Hare, and grows and shrinks in unpredictable ways. . As
Alice navigates this strange land, she learns valuable lessons about identity, logic, and
the absurdity of adult behavior.Eventually, she wakes up to find that it was all a dream,
but the experiences and insights gained during her journey stay with her.

Discussion: Lewis Carroll's "Alice in Wonderland" is a timeless classic that captivates


readers with its whimsical characters, imaginative settings, and thought-provoking
themes. Through Alice's adventures, the story explores concepts of identity,
imagination, and the fluidity of reality. The absurd situations and characters serve as a
commentary on Victorian society, with Carroll using satire and wordplay to challenge
conventional logic and societal norms. Overall, "Alice in Wonderland" continues to
attract readers of all ages with imaginative storytelling and endless lessons.

Essay:
Technology has become an integral part of education, revolutionizing the way students
learn and teachers teach. In today's digital age, technology in education encompasses a
wide range of tools and resources aimed at enhancing the learning experience.
Advancements in technology have led to the development of digital learning platforms,
interactive educational software, and online resources that have transformed traditional
classrooms into dynamic learning environments.

One of the primary advantages of technology in education is its ability to provide


students with access to a vast amount of information. With the internet and digital
libraries, students can explore a diverse range of topics and resources beyond the
confines of traditional textbooks. Moreover, technology facilitates personalized learning
by allowing students to learn at their own pace and cater to their individual learning
styles. Adaptive learning platforms and educational apps can tailor content to meet the
unique needs and abilities of each student, fostering a more engaging and effective
learning experience.

Furthermore, technology has revolutionized teaching methods and resources, enabling


educators to create interactive lessons, multimedia presentations, and virtual
simulations that enhance student engagement and comprehension. Collaborative tools
and communication platforms facilitate seamless interaction and collaboration among
students and teachers, breaking down geographical barriers and fostering global
learning communities.

However, the integration of technology in education is not without challenges and


concerns. The digital divide persists, with disparities in access to technology and
internet connectivity exacerbating educational inequalities. Moreover, the ubiquitous
nature of technology poses risks such as distraction, misuse, and over-dependence,
raising concerns about its impact on student well-being and academic performance.
Privacy and security issues also loom large, highlighting the need for robust safeguards
to protect sensitive student data and ensure online safety.
To address these challenges, effective strategies for the integration of technology in
education are essential. Providing equitable access to technology and internet
connectivity is paramount to bridge the digital divide and ensure that all students can
benefit from digital learning opportunities. Additionally, comprehensive technology
training for educators is essential to equip them with the skills and knowledge necessary
to leverage technology effectively in the classroom. Clear policies and guidelines should
be established to manage technology use and promote responsible digital citizenship.
Furthermore, a balanced approach that combines technology with traditional teaching
methods can maximize the benefits of both approaches and cater to the diverse needs
of learners.

In conclusion, technology has had a profound impact on education, offering immense


potential to enhance learning outcomes and transform educational practices. While the
advantages of technology in education are undeniable, it is crucial to address the
associated challenges and concerns proactively. By leveraging technology responsibly
and implementing effective strategies for its integration, we can harness its power to
create more inclusive, engaging, and effective learning environments for all students.

Title: "The Gift of the Magi" by O. Henry

Summary:
"The Gift of the Magi" is a heartwarming story about a young couple, Jim and Della, who
are deeply in love but financially struggling. With Christmas approaching, they both want
to give each other a special gift but have no money. Della decides to sell her beautiful
long hair to buy Jim a chain for his prized pocket watch, while Jim sells his watch to buy
Della a set of combs for her hair. On Christmas Eve, they exchange their gifts only to
discover the sacrifices they've made for each other. Despite the irony of their actions,
their love and selflessness shine through, making their simple gifts truly precious.

Analysis/Moral Lesson:

The story beautifully illustrates the sacrificial nature of love and the true essence of
gift-giving. It emphasizes the importance of selflessness, empathy, and the willingness
to sacrifice for the happiness of loved ones. Through Jim and Della's actions, O. Henry
reminds us that material possessions are secondary to the love and devotion shared
between individuals. It teaches us that the value of a gift lies not in its monetary worth
but in the thoughtfulness and love behind it.
